LEGO Star Wars: Rebuild the Galaxy (Limited Series)

Stream on September 13


LEGO Star Wars: Rebuild the Galaxy is a family-friendly animated series part of the LEGO Star Wars franchise. The latest adventure takes a bit of a different turn than its predecessors and offers viewers a different version of what the world of Star Wars could have been. When an ordinary nerf-herder named Sig Greebling (Gaten Matarazzo) discovers an old relic inside a hidden Jedi temple, he accidentally rewrites reality.

Now, in a world turned completely upside down where the good guys are bad, and the bad guys are good, Sig is determined to make things right and return everything to the way it was before. With the help of an elusive and long-forgotten Jedi, Sig will have to become the kind of hero he’s always admired to piece the universe back together. The limited series includes voice performances by Tony Revolori, Bobby Moynihan, Marsai Martin, Michael Cusack, Ahmed Best, and Mark Hamill. LEGO Star Wars: Rebuild the Galaxy is streaming on Sept. 13.


Dancing with the Stars (Season 33)

Stream on September 17

Ever since Dancing with the Stars premiered nearly 20 years ago on ABC, it has continued to delight its fans. A dance competition series, the show pairs professional dancers with celebrities who then compete with other couples for judges’ points and audience votes. Each week, the couple with the lowest scores and votes is eliminated until only one remains. Hosted by Alfonso Ribeiro and Julianne Hough, the series’ panel of judges includes Carrie Ann Inaba, Derek Hough, and Bruno Tonioli.


Currently, only American gymnast and Olympic bronze medal winner Stephen Nedoroscik has been confirmed for the upcoming season. However, those rumored to be joining the competition series include former Philadelphia Eagles center Jason Kelce, rugby Olympian Ilona Maher, former Golden Bachelor Gerry Turner, and Australian breakdancer Raygun. Dancing with the Stars Season 33 is streaming on Sept. 17.

Agatha All Along (Season 1)

Stream on September 18


Agatha All Along is the latest Marvel spin-off series centered around the villainous witch, Agatha (Kathryn Hahn), whom viewers first saw in WandaVision. The show takes place in the aftermath of its predecessor’s finale as Agatha (Kathryn Hahn) escapes Wanda’s (Elizabeth Olsen) spell in Westview with the help of a goth named Teen (Joe Locke). While she’s no longer trapped, she still remains without her powers.

To regain what she has lost, the sarcastic and sassy witch seeks to form a new coven of witches to face the trials of the legendary Witches’ Road and ultimately regain the power Wanda stripped from her. Full of various tribulations, the road clearly won’t be as simple as Agatha thought. She might have assembled a myriad of fellow witches to assist her, but Agatha remains as conniving as ever and likely shouldn’t be trusted.


If her previous endeavors are any indication, the loyalties she maintains only go as far as her own self-interest. Because she’s betrayed plenty of witches in her life, including her previous coven, it seems abundantly clear she would have no problem doing it once more if it meant her powers would be returned. Agatha All Along is streaming on Sept. 18.

Ayla & the Mirrors (Season 1)

Stream on September 27


Ayla & the Mirrors is a Spanish-language family drama series about a spoiled rich girl named Ayla (Violeta Madel) whose world turns upside down in an instant. After losing her father, Ayla is left with no memories and no one to claim her. As a result, she is sent to the El Bosque shelter. While there, she encounters a dance group known as Inés and The Mirrors, which sparks something inside her.

Surprisingly, she discovers a unique ability: she can hear the feelings of others via musical visions that come to her unexpectedly. As such, she begins to thrive. However, during her time at the El Bosque shelter, her aunt Esmeralda (Mar Abascal) aims to keep a close eye on her and her actions to ensure Ayla doesn’t become a threat to her aunt’s newly inherited fortune. Ayla & the Mirrors is streaming on Sept. 27.
